上一篇
虚机跟物理机的区别
- 物理机
- 2025-07-31
- 2
机无硬件实体,共享物理资源;物理机有实体硬件,性能强且资源独占,前者管理灵活成本低,后者扩展贵
机(虚拟机)与物理机是两种截然不同的计算环境,各自具有独特的特点和适用场景,以下是关于二者区别的详细介绍:
特性 | 物理机 | 虚拟机 |
---|---|---|
硬件实体性 | 由实际硬件组件构成(CPU、内存、硬盘等),存在物理形态 | 无独立硬件,通过虚拟化技术模拟出逻辑上的完整计算机系统 |
资源分配方式 | 独占全部硬件资源,不与其他设备共享 | 共享所在物理机的硬件资源,需预先分配配额(如指定vCPU核心数、内存容量) |
隔离级别 | 硬件级强制隔离,天然保障安全性 | 软件定义的隔离层(依赖Hypervisor稳定性),存在理论突破风险 |
性能表现 | 零虚拟化损耗,直接调用硬件能力,性能接近理论上限 | 存在5%-20%的性能开销(因虚拟化层的介入) |
配置灵活性 | 固定配置调整困难,扩容需更换物理部件 | 支持动态资源调配(在线增加vCPU/磁盘空间),分钟级完成变更 |
操作系统支持 | 通常单系统运行(特殊方案除外) | 可同时承载多操作系统实例(如Windows+Linux共存于同一物理机) |
故障影响范围 | 单点故障仅影响自身 | 宿主机故障可能导致多个关联虚拟机瘫痪 |
迁移便捷性 | 需物理运输设备,成本高昂且耗时 | 通过镜像文件实现即时迁移,支持跨地域快速部署 |
初始投入成本 | 高(含硬件采购、机房建设等费用) | 低(利用现有物理机资源池化) |
管理复杂度 | 逐台维护,自动化程度有限 | 可通过集中管控平台批量操作(如VMware vCenter) |
数据安全性 | 天然防御虚拟机逃逸攻击,适合金融/政务等敏感领域 | 需强化Hypervisor层防护,防止跨虚拟机侧信道攻击 |
特殊场景适配 | 工控设备直连、硬件开发调试等需直接访问PCIe设备的场合 | 云计算弹性伸缩、开发测试环境快速克隆等场景优势明显 |
典型应用场景对比
- 物理机适用场景:高性能计算(HPC)、核心数据库集群、实时金融交易系统、工业控制终端、大规模存储阵列,这类场景对硬件确定性、最低延迟和绝对稳定性有严苛要求,例如科学仿真中需要无干扰的浮点运算单元持续工作,或证券交易平台要求微秒级的订单处理响应。
- 虚拟机适用场景:Web应用托管、混合云架构编排、多租户PaaS服务、灾备演练环境,当业务负载具有波动性时,虚拟化的资源调度优势尤为突出,如电商平台在大促期间临时扩容数百个电商前端实例,活动结束后快速释放资源。
运维管理差异
物理机的维护涉及硬件健康监测(如风扇转速检测、内存条ECC校验)、固件升级(BIOS/RAID卡微码更新)、机房环境调控(温湿度控制、防火系统联动),而虚拟机的日常管理更多集中在镜像模板制作、快照策略制定、动态资源调度算法优化等方面,值得注意的是,超融合架构中物理机与虚拟机的界限正在模糊——通过分布式资源调度器,可实现跨节点的虚拟机热迁移,将物理机的可靠性与虚拟化的灵活性相结合。
FAQs
-
问:为什么银行核心系统更倾向于使用物理机?
答:主要基于三个考量:①避免虚拟化层的潜在安全破绽(如Hypervisor被攻破导致多租户数据泄露);②满足监管要求的物理隔离特性;③确保极端情况下的资源独占性(如突发交易洪峰时无需考虑其他虚拟机的资源竞争)。 -
问:如何判断业务是否适合从物理机迁移到虚拟机?
答:关键评估维度包括:①业务类型是否属于计算密集型(如视频编码更适合物理机);②是否存在明显的周期性负载波动(适合虚拟化弹性扩展);③容灾等级需求(RTO/RPO指标是否允许基于快照的备份方案);④硬件利用率统计(持续低于40%的机器更适合虚拟化整合),建议进行压力测试验证目标场景下的虚拟化性能